Just because CubeCraft is a 1.9 server doesn't mean it can't have a 1.8 community.
But it is 1.9. For people who love 1.9, it's nice having a server to play on.

Well I'm sorry if I don't want to have to take a break from fighting every 10 seconds to eat a steak. So I get constant regeneration 2. Food is still very overpowered in 1.12 and make fights take longer. Turning food into healing was a very silly idea.
Well in 1.8, being in range of someone for more than a second is extremely unlikely, it's very different, it's as if both players are bayblades rubbing against each other rather than strafing. I find aiming in 1.9 a lot like quickscoping in a first person shooter, you don't need to constantly keep your crosshair on them but rather only when the sword is recharged.

Why does fight length matter? It's still just as much of a rush. A single second isn't going to matter unless you don't use it well (like if you miss). I don't get the complaint of "It makes the fights longer." You're playing PvP, a fight is a fight. I like the fact that it's a lot harder to get out of a fight once you're in it. While the battles take longer, there's often time a definitive winner more often. Once your armour breaks or your food gets low, It's basically over. There's not as much of a chance to retreat and heal unless you have a teammate.

Cleaning isn't that much of an issue. When someone else attacks you after you've just taken a beating, they deserve to win. That's strategy. Wait till your opponents whittle each other down then attack.

The armour durability issue you talk about isn't really an issue. You're rewarded for being more prepared. Also, if you're good enough, you can beat people even if you have worse armour. I'm not this skilled, but I have a friend who's taken on three, fully iron-armoured players, in leather armour with a stone sword. He beat them. While 1.9 is armour-based in basic fighting, other tactics can negate this.
